Transaction e6824f70d0356656792519356b62d32933a5c1be5d7b09dae04c3527c0cd262a
1 Input
1 Output
-
e6824f70d0356656792519356b62d32933a5c1be5d7b09dae04c3527c0cd262a:0
- value
- 15311
- script pubkey
- OP_0 OP_PUSHBYTES_32 c27fd5431b6cab405ea81e8e8499a8d1013d7cab2a0345d001a03c19bd826cd7
- address
- bc1qcfla2scmdj45qh4gr68gfxdg6yqn6l9t9gp5t5qp5q7pn0vzdnts9nz8jc